I'm not sure many people are hoping for big "rebounds."

Niskanen has no "rebound" needed, his second half and playoff performance were pretty much back to his norm, and I expect AV will cut back his load slightly to keep his old legs fresh. He's more of a defensive player the last couple years, with O-zone starts < 40% in the playoffs.
Playoff xGF% last four seasons: 53.54, 55.29, 54.03, 54.05 - doesn't get more consistent than that!

Braun is past his peak, and no one refutes that, he's not going to be a major cog, he'll partner with Sanheim and basically CYA for him. Play some PK. If Myers steps up the second half, look for Braun's TOI to be gradually reduced.

Hayes is going to "revert" - to what? He's 27, so it's not like he's gonna suddenly do a Dorian Grey on you.
ES scoring: 39, 30, 35, 34, 41. PP 5, 6, 7, 8, 11. It's not like last season was some anomaly.
If anything, he's more likely to take it up a notch than take a step backwards, as he's become a two way forward.
